Hello! I've had my eye on the MamaRoo since I found out I was pregnant. It was on our registry, but unfortunately we didn't receive it as a gift. While it looked amazing, we just couldn't justify spending over $200 on it.  At around 5 weeks old, our baby girl wasn't sleeping well at night, and we were willing to try anything! I found someone selling their MamaRoo for $100! It was a steal!  It was completely easy to set-up, and the controls are self-explanatory. The different movements and sounds give us a good variety too. My only complaints would be the fact that we can't dim the control screen. In the middle of the night, it's pretty bright and we usually have to put something on it to drown out the light. I would also love if the mobile would spin on its own. Hello, hello! Hope everyone is doing well! We have our Rock'n'Play in our living room. It's really convenient to be able to lay our little girl down whenever we need both hands. She sleeps in it occasionally, but that's with any chair, swing, etc.  It was really easy to put together! I had it done in less than 30 minutes. I followed the instructions exactly! I had one bout of confusion when trying to figure out which way the legs face, but it was easy to correct once I saw my error.  My two favorite things about the Rock'n'Play are 1) how easy it is to fold up and carry around and 2) how my baby essentially "rocks" herself because of the design. I only wish there was a way to have it rock automatically as well. There's been many times where my husband and I had to stay up rocking our baby girl just do that she'd stay asleep.  Overall, it's a great seat! I'm definitely one of those people that love super hot showers/baths, and when I think something is cold, others  might think it's hot. This temperature spout cover is a lifesaver! I don't have to worry about the water being too hot when I make my baby girl's bath. It's easy to install (and you only need a couple batteries), and crazy easy to understand. If the water is too hot, it start beeping loudly and the screen starts flashing red. The screens give you an exact reading of the temperature too. I know 4Moms makes an actual baby tub as well, but I opted for the spout because I had a baby tub already (I love hand-me-downs!).
